- The distance between Muren, Mongolia and Pilar Obs, Argentina is approximately 17,617 km or 10,948 mi.
- To reach Muren in this distance one would set out from Pilar Obs bearing 29°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Muren bearing 140.5° or SE .
- Muren has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Pilar Obs has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- Muren is in or near the subpolar wet tundra biome whereas Pilar Obs is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 19.1 °C (34.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 25.8 °C (46.4°F) more in Muren.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 583.5 mm (23 in) less which is equivalent to 583.5 l/m² (14.32 US gal/ft²) or 5,835,000 l/ha (623,800 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 17.2° lower in Muren than in Pilar Obs.
